Twantry Fm
Early-attested site in the Parish of Clipston
Historical Forms
- Twantr' 1381 ADiii
Etymology
Twantry Fm (6″) is Twantr '1381 AD iii. This may be from OE (æt þæm ) twǣm trēowum , '(at the) two trees.' Cf. Tweynthornes in Brixworth (14thNthStA ), Tweynok in Eye (c. 1400Rental ).
